Introduction
The TL431AILPR is a precision shunt voltage reference integrated circuit (IC) that provides an adjustable voltage reference for a wide range of applications.
Product Features and Performance
Adjustable output voltage from 2.495V to 36V
Output current up to 100mA
Tight voltage tolerance of ±1%
Wide operating temperature range of -40°C to 85°C
Low current consumption of 700μA

Key Technical Parameters
Voltage Output Range: 2.495V to 36V
Output Current: 100mA
Voltage Tolerance: ±1%
Cathode Current: 700μA
Operating Temperature Range: -40°C to 85°C

Application Areas
Voltage regulation circuits
Feedback control loops
Analog-to-digital converters
Microprocessor and microcontroller voltage references
Industrial and consumer electronics
